Premiership giants vying for Cavani; Roma to bid for Matija Nastasic

hot-transfer-newsPremiership giants vying for Cavani

Manchester United, Arsenal and Liverpool are locked in the battle for Paris Saint-Germain striker Edinson Cavani, according to Daily Express.

The highly rated forward is believed to be looking for a way out of Parc des Princes given that he is unhappy at being played on the wing.

And with the Saints already eyeing possible replacements, there is a chance the Uruguayan could leave in the January window.

This has put the likes of Manchester United, Arsenal and Liverpool on alert, with the Premier League sides closely monitoring the situation.

With centre forward role reserved for Zlatan Ibrahimovic, Cavani has mostly been used on the wing, but he still managed 19 goals in 39 league outings.

Roma to bid for Matija Nastasic

Italian giants AS Roma have informed Manchester City of their interest in Serbian defender Matija Nastasic, Daily Star can reveal.

The Giallorossi missed out on the Serbia international in the summer, but they are ready to launch a fresh assault on January.

Roma officials used their Champions League trip to the Etihad to inquire about the possibility of signing Nastasic .

The Giallorossi have already signed Kostas Manolas, Davide Astori and Mapou Yanga-Mbiwa in the summer window, but the problem is that only the Greek defender has been recruited on permanent basis.

And with Matija Nastasic likely to be available on a cut-price deal in January, Roma are ready to pounce.

The 21-year-old has shown some potential since arriving from Fiorentina, making 34 Premier League appearances, but he has seen his stock fall a great deal over the last year or so.

Steve Mandanda coy on exit talk

Marseille goalkeeper Steve Mandanda has refused to deny the possibility of leaving the club in the January transfer window.

The experienced shot-stopper has spent last seven years at Stade Velodrome and he was linked with a summer exit.

Mandanda has another two years left on his contract, meaning that Marseille could still earn a nice profit if they sell the player in January, but the 29-year-old is unconcerned by the transfer talk.

The France international has, however, admitted that a winter exit remains a realistic possibility at the moment.

“I do not know if I will leave OM, I may remain at the club for the remainder of my career, but also leave in January,” Mandanda told Telefoot.

Since joining the club from Le Havre, Mandanda has made 269 Ligue 1 appearances and it’s been over four years since he last missed a league fixture.
